
Germany Ecommerce Customs Clearance Explained
05.05.2026
DHL Rebrand Changes for German Ecommerce Sellers
08.05.2026

FLEX. Logistics
We provide logistics services to online retailers in Europe: Amazon FBA prep, processing FBA removal orders, forwarding to Fulfillment Centers - both FBA and Vendor shipments.
A shipment arrives at Hamburg or Frankfurt, customs documentation is incomplete, and the broker handling your declaration is unreachable. By the time the issue surfaces, your goods are sitting in a temporary storage facility accumulating daily fees, and your delivery window to the end customer has already closed. This is not a rare edge case. It is one of the most common operational failures importers face when working with the wrong customs agent in Germany.
Choosing a customs agent is not a procurement decision you make once and forget. It is an active control point in your import workflow. The agent you select determines how quickly your goods clear German customs, who owns the declaration process when something goes wrong, and whether your documentation holds up under a post-clearance audit. The right agent reduces dwell time, protects your EORI registration from compliance exposure, and keeps your inbound supply chain moving on schedule. This article helps you compare your options, understand the selection criteria that actually matter, and make a defensible decision for your operation.
What a Customs Agent in Germany Actually Does
A customs agent — also called a customs broker or Zollagent — acts as the authorised representative submitting import declarations to German customs authorities on your behalf. In practice, this means the agent files the entry in ATLAS, Germany's electronic customs declaration system, assigns the correct commodity codes, calculates applicable duties and VAT, and manages any holds, inspections, or queries that arise during clearance.
What separates a capable agent from a problematic one is not the filing itself — most agents can submit a declaration. The difference is what happens around the declaration: how the agent handles missing documents, who contacts the carrier when a consignment note does not match the invoice, and whether the agent proactively flags a tariff classification risk before the shipment arrives rather than after it is held.
For importers shipping regularly into Germany, the agent also manages the relationship with the customs office at the port or airport of entry. Agents with established working relationships at Hamburg, Bremen, or Frankfurt Airport often resolve routine queries faster than agents operating remotely without local presence. When evaluating customs services in Germany, local operational footprint is a factor worth checking, not just the quoted fee per declaration.
- Declaration filing: ATLAS submission, commodity codes, duty calculation
- Document management: commercial invoice, packing list, certificates of origin
- Exception handling: holds, inspections, tariff queries, post-clearance corrections
- Compliance ownership: who is liable if the declaration contains an error
Using an External Customs Agent
Most importers working with Germany use an external customs agent, either a standalone broker or a freight forwarder with in-house customs capability. This model works well when your import volumes are moderate, your commodity mix is relatively stable, and you do not have the internal headcount to maintain customs expertise.
The key control point with an external agent is the instruction handoff. The agent can only declare what you give them. If your commercial invoice arrives late, contains the wrong Incoterms, or omits a required certificate, the agent cannot file — and your goods wait. Establishing a clear pre-shipment document checklist and a named contact on both sides is the single most effective way to reduce clearance delays when using an external logistics broker in Germany.
Choose an external agent if your import frequency does not justify a full-time in-house customs function, or if you are entering the German market for the first time and need a partner who already knows the local customs office procedures and tariff classification norms for your product category.
Managing Customs In-House
Larger importers with high declaration volumes sometimes bring customs management in-house, employing a licensed customs declarant directly. This gives you full visibility into every declaration, faster internal escalation when a shipment is held, and direct control over how your commodity codes are maintained and updated.
The risk is concentration. If your in-house declarant is unavailable during a peak import window — illness, holiday, or staff turnover — your clearance process has no backup. German customs does not pause for internal resourcing gaps. A single missed filing deadline can trigger a customs hold that cascades into a warehouse receiving failure and a stockout.
In-house customs management also requires ongoing investment in ATLAS system access, customs software licences, and continuous training as tariff schedules and import regulations change. For most small and mid-size importers, the cost-to-serve of an in-house function exceeds the cost of a well-managed external agent relationship. Choose in-house only when declaration volume, product complexity, and internal compliance requirements genuinely justify the overhead.
The Agent Selection Checklist That Matters
Most importers evaluate customs agents on price alone. That is the wrong starting point. A broker charging a lower fee per declaration but missing a tariff classification error on your first shipment will cost you far more in back-duties and penalties than the fee difference ever saved.
Before signing an agreement with any customs agent in Germany, work through these control points:
- ATLAS authorisation: Confirm the agent is registered and active in the German customs system
- Commodity code experience: Ask for examples of declarations in your product category — not just a general capability claim
- SLA commitment: Get a written response time for routine declarations and for exception handling when a shipment is held
- Named contact: Identify who owns your account day-to-day and who covers when that person is absent
- Error correction process: Ask how the agent handles post-clearance amendments and who bears the cost of corrections caused by agent error
An agent who cannot answer these questions clearly during the selection process will not answer them clearly when your shipment is sitting in a customs hold on a Friday afternoon.

SLAs, Communication, and the Hidden Cost of a Slow Agent
The commercial damage from a slow or unresponsive customs agent rarely appears on a single invoice. It accumulates across multiple shipments: a two-day clearance delay here, a missed delivery window there, a storage fee that was never budgeted. Over a quarter of regular imports, these costs can exceed the total annual fee paid to the agent — yet most importers do not track them at the declaration level.
When reviewing import agent options in Germany, ask specifically about SLA structure. A credible agent will distinguish between standard clearance timelines for pre-lodged declarations and expedited handling for time-sensitive shipments. They will also be transparent about what falls outside their SLA — for example, delays caused by customs authority inspections, which no agent can control, versus delays caused by incomplete documentation, which the agent and importer share responsibility for preventing.
Communication protocol is equally important. Establish upfront whether the agent will notify you proactively when a declaration is queued, when it is released, and when an exception arises — or whether you are expected to chase status updates yourself. Agents operating with a reactive communication model create invisible delays: you do not know there is a problem until the problem has already cost you time.
One practical test during agent selection: send a sample shipment scenario with a deliberate documentation gap and ask the agent how they would handle it. Their response — speed, clarity, and whether they identify the gap at all — tells you more about their operational capability than any reference list.

Who Owns the Declaration: Liability and Compliance Control
One of the most misunderstood aspects of working with a customs agent in Germany is the question of liability. When an agent files a declaration on your behalf as indirect representative, both the importer and the agent carry legal responsibility for the accuracy of that declaration. If the commodity code is wrong, the duty underpaid, or a required import licence missing, the importer cannot simply point to the agent and walk away from the obligation.
This is why the compliance handoff between importer and agent must be explicit, not assumed. The importer is responsible for providing accurate product descriptions, correct values, and valid supporting documents. The agent is responsible for translating that information into a correct declaration and flagging any inconsistency before filing.
When evaluating customs clearance support in Germany, ask the agent directly: what is your process when you receive documents that appear inconsistent with the declared value or origin? An agent who files without questioning is not protecting you — they are transferring risk to you. A capable agent will pause, query, and document the resolution before submitting. That pause is not inefficiency. It is the control point that keeps your import record clean.
Operational Fit
Match the agent's experience to your product category and import frequency. An agent handling mainly industrial machinery may not have the tariff classification depth needed for regulated consumer goods or food imports. Ask for declaration examples in your commodity area before committing to any customs services arrangement.
Visibility and Reporting
A good agent provides declaration status updates without being chased. Confirm whether the agent uses a tracking portal, sends proactive notifications on release and exceptions, and can provide monthly declaration summaries for your internal compliance records. Lack of reporting visibility is an early warning sign of a reactive operation.
Exception Escalation
Ask who handles a customs hold when your named contact is unavailable. Every agent relationship needs a documented escalation path — a second contact, a team lead, or a duty manager — so that a Friday hold does not become a Monday problem. Agents without a clear escalation structure create single points of failure in your import chain.
Making the Right Call on Your Customs Agent
The decision between an external customs agent and an in-house function comes down to three variables: your declaration volume, your product complexity, and your tolerance for operational risk when the primary contact is unavailable. For most importers operating in Germany at moderate scale, a well-selected external agent with a clear SLA, a named account contact, and a documented escalation path will outperform an under-resourced in-house function.
What you are really selecting is not just a filing service. You are selecting who owns the exception when something goes wrong at the border — and how fast that exception gets resolved before it becomes a supply chain disruption. That ownership question should be answered before the first shipment, not during a customs hold.
Before finalising your agent selection, run through the checklist in this article: ATLAS authorisation, commodity code experience, SLA terms, named contacts, and error correction process. If any of those points cannot be answered clearly by the agent during the evaluation, treat that as a disqualifying signal, not a minor gap to revisit later.
For importers who need customs clearance support in Germany combined with pre-clearance document preparation, bonded storage, or forwarding to Amazon fulfilment centres, working with a logistics partner who integrates customs handling into the broader inbound workflow removes the coordination gap between clearance and delivery.

Ready to Expand in Germany?
Take advantage of FLEX. Logistik Germany and streamline your operations in one of Europe’s most competitive e-commerce markets. From FBA Prep Center Germany and Pre Amazon Storage to efficient B2C & B2B Fulfilment Service, we provide everything you need to scale. We also support Forwarding to Amazon in Germany, Customs Clearance, and smooth Amazon Removals and Returns processing—so your logistics run without friction.
Ready to grow your business in Germany? Contact FLEX. Logistik Germany and let’s create a solution tailored to your goals. Visit our news section for the latest insights, updates, and practical tips for selling across Europe.
Learn more about our services and European network: FLEX. Logistics EU, FLEX. Fulfillment, FLEX. Logistique France, FBA Prep France, FBA Prep Poland, FBA Prep Germany.
Grow faster in Germany with a logistics partner you can rely on.









